Mumbai (Maharashtra) [India], February 6: NoBroker, India's first proptech unicorn, is set to host its much-anticipated Property Carnival on February 8th and 9th, 2025, at Radisson Blu, Andheri East, Mumbai. Homebuyers will have the unique chance to explore a wide array of housing options from top-tier real estate developers, including Godrej, Rustomjee Group, AVA Lifespaces, Dosti Realty, Runwal Group, JP Infra, DGS Group, Paradigm, and Sanghvi Realty, all under one roof.

This two-day event offers a convenient, time-saving platform for those looking to purchase their dream homes.
